Artur Maurer (born November 17 jul. / The thirtieth November 1904 greg. , † unknown) was an Estonian footballer Baltic German origin.
Career
Artur Maurer played in his club career, which lasted from 1926 to 1928, with JK Tallinna Kalev .
In July 1926, Maurer made his debut in the Estonian national team in the friendly international match against Sweden , which was played in Tallinn .
In 1927 he completed another international match against Lithuania in Kaunas , which ended with a 5-0 away win for the Estonians .
The last two of a total of four international matches, in which he scored a total of two goals, made Maurer during the Baltic Cup in 1928 , the first edition of this tournament. In the game against Lithuania, he scored two goals in the second half .
